Ruth Marcum, 77, Vermilion resident since 1961

Ruth Marcum (nee Collins), age 77, of Vermilion, died Tuesday, August 19, 2003 at her home after a lengthy illness.

She was born on July 21, 1926 in Trosper, KY and has been a Vermilion resident since 1961.

She was a member of the Free Pentecostal Church of God in South Amherst.

Survivors include 2 daughters, Reba Chappellow of Wilmington, OH, and Patty Marsh of Bedford, KY; 2 sons, Willie Marcum of Birmingham, OH, and Douglas Marcum of Vermilion, OH; 7 grandchildren; 14 great-grandchildren; 4 sisters, Jewell Lee of Ft.Wright, KY, Blois rice of Trosper, KY, Havanna Butler of Trosper, KY, and Vera Moore of Coshocton, OH; 4 Brothers, Langley Collins of Kipton, OH, Loxley Collins of Norwalk, OH, James Collins of Nashville, TN and Herman Collins of Vermilion.

She was preceded-in-death by her husband, Ambers Marcum in 1984; parents, Wayne and Dora Patsy (nee Lawson) Collins; 2 daughters, Gloria and Sherry Marcum; son, Daryl Marcum; 2 grandchildren, Bruce Marcum and Gloria Sturdivant.

The family will receive friends on Wednesday, August 20, 2003 from 6-8 p.m. and on Thursday, August 21, 2003 from 2-4 and 7-9 p.m. at the Riddle Funeral Home, 5345 South Street, Vermilion, Ohio.

Services will be held at the Riddle Funeral Home on Friday, August 22, 2003 at 10:00 a.m. Interment will follow in Maple Grove Cemetery, Vermilion.
